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Clapham High Street to Ellesmere Port start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Clapham High Street to Ellesmere Port start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Clapham High Street to Ellesmere Port are available for £163.60 one way, or £327.20 return

Station Facilities and Services

Clapham High Street station simplifies ticketing with accessible ticket machines ready for use. Though there isn’t a traditional ticket office, purchasing and collecting tickets online is straightforward and convenient. Smartcards are not issued here, so ensure to have valid tickets beforehand. While the station provides visible customer help points and information screens, it's important to note that there are no staffed helplines at the station.

Accessibility is somewhat limited at Clapham High Street with Category C classification, indicating no step-free access. Also, there are no accessible toilets or ramps for train access. While seating is available on both platforms, waiting rooms and lounges are absent, meaning you'll want to plan your stay accordingly when traveling.

Amenities and Onward Travel

Clapham High Street is a utilitarian station, and as such, lacks facilities like refreshment areas, shops, or public Wi-Fi. However, its strategic location offers excellent external amenities. The station is enveloped by an array of local cafes and shops, perfect for preparing for your journey or grabbing a quick bite.

For those needing to continue their journey beyond the station, there are several transport links. Bus stops nearby provide easy connectivity, with routes available for both southbound and northbound services. You're conveniently located a mere three-minute walk from Clapham North London Underground station if you need an underground ride on the Northern line. Additionally, you can organize taxi services in advance through reliable platforms like Addison Lee and Gett.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

When traveling from Ellesmere Port, purchasing and collecting tickets is straightforward with a ticket office open from 5:30 AM to 2:00 PM on weekdays. While ticket machines are available, it’s worth noting that you cannot collect tickets bought online here, so plan accordingly. For those who prefer a contactless experience, smartcards can be acquired and validated onsite.

The station provides partial step-free access, making it easier for passengers with different mobility needs to navigate. Accessible provisions include an induction loop and ramps for train access, though certain areas such as accessible toilets and waiting rooms are unavailable. Looking for assistance? Staff are on hand to help from early morning until mid-afternoon during the week. Also, be sure to check the latest Passenger Assist options to make your journey even smoother.

Onward Travel Options

Ellesmere Port is well-connected to various transport links to ensure seamless onward travel. If you need to hop onto a bus or taxi, you'll find pick-up and drop-off points outside the station. The Merseytravel website offers comprehensive information about local bus services. Heading to Liverpool John Lennon Airport? Simply purchase a rail/bus combo ticket to reach the airport via Liverpool South Parkway station, followed by a quick bus ride.
